The Electronic System for Travel Authorization isn't thought of a visa, but a prerequisite to traveling by air or sea to the United States under the Visa Waiver Program. ESTA has an software fee of $4, and if permitted, an additional charge of $10 is charged. Once obtained, the authorization is valid for as a lot as two years or until the traveler's passport expires, whichever comes first, and is legitimate for a number of entries into the United States. Passengers are advised to use for ESTA at least seventy two hours earlier than departure.

The government of the People's Republic of China allows holders of odd passports issued by some nations to journey to Mainland China for tourism or enterprise purposes for up to 15, 30, 60 or ninety days with out having to acquire a visa. Visitors of different nationalities, in addition to residents of Hong Kong and Macau, are required to acquire either a visa or a permit prior to arrival, depending on their nationality.

The rules say that to increase a stay period as shown on a visa, apply 7 days earlier than the present stay visa expires. To prolong the residence interval shown on a residence allow, apply 30 days earlier than the current residence allow expires.
